So I took my new steed Sheila on our first outing. A friend of mine came over to accompany us out on a walk. This sign made me giggle as I’m not sure we’d hit that heady speeds. At least Sheila didn’t spook at anything.

It was good to be outdoors and we missed the rain. But it really brought home to me how hard it must be for anyone who’s in a wheelchair or mobility scooter. The pavements were undulating, the edges weren’t uneven and I really had to pay attention where we were going. Only had to reverse once as the pavement ended and navigate our way round some roadworks. It’s really opening my eyes.
